Naturism acts as a powerful corrective to this "visual diet." In a naturist environment, you see bodies of all ages, stages, and conditions. You see the reality of gravity, the diversity of anatomy, and the simple functionality of the human form. When nudity is social and non-sexual, the "spectacle" of the body vanishes.
